Three Hypolipidemic Drugs Increase Hepatic Palmitoyl-Coenzyme A Oxidation in the Rat

Male rats treated with clofibrate, tibric acid, or Wy-14,643 show an 11- to 18-fold increase in the capacity of their livers to oxidize palmitoyl-coenzyme A. This provides a plausible biochemical mechanism for the action of these hypolipidemic drugs in reducing lipid concentrations in the serum.
